RapRehab is glad to support Beats, Rhymes & Relief 501(c)3 is a Washington D.C. based non-profit with their mission to use the arts in raising awareness and support for global humanitarian relief efforts.  We are focusing on hip hop music as the main thrust of our communication efforts for this yearOur approach is to bring people together and foster positive relationships through hip hop music

 

In an effort to create a grass roots movement the Making Beats Count video contest is a part of our “Calling On Your City”campaign to increase the level of community engagement and involvement in social impact issues.

At each event we strive to bridge gaps in community, culture, age and gender through a day of community engagement and ideally some kind of act of social good. In the past we have done book bag drives, winter clothing drives, free haircuts etc for the youth in the community. Plus watching some of the world’s most conscious MC’s make the video, makes for a great day.

 

By painting the mural with messages of peace and community involvement as well as bringing the musicians and community leaders out to engage the the youth we believe we are able to inspire participants and neighborhood residents to participate in local programs for social good for years to come.
